How to Create a Sunday Routine: 9 Game-Changing Ideas
Here’s the thing about creating a Sunday routine: it can look however you’d like. The only requirement? The rituals and practices you weave into your weekend wind-down need to support you. So if a yoga flow helps you connect with your body before a stressful Monday, go for it! But if you’d rather connect with your mind through a good book, nothing should stop you from spending hours in literary bliss.
Investing in yourself, your health, and your happiness is key to living a meaningful and aligned life—and you get to decide exactly what that looks like.
But who doesn’t love to feel inspired? *Raises hand* To help us all along our Sunday routine journey, I looked to some of the most successful people I know across every industry. Below, I’m sharing the best advice from CEOs, influencers, founders, and more. Keep reading to learn how they spend their Sundays to set themselves up for success in the week ahead.

Reframe How You Think About Sundays
“Being open-minded and positive about what’s coming next and staying focused on my goals keeps the Sunday Scaries away.” — Laura Lee, make-up artist, YouTuber, entrepreneur, and blogger
Create Structure for Your Kids
“[My husband and I] turn down all the lights in the house to remind our kids that it’s time for them (and us) to wind down. I actually really enjoy my alone cleaning time—it settles my thoughts for the day and allows me to focus on being present for the last hour my children are awake.” — Brandy Joy Smith, content creator, interior designer, and Camille Styles Motherhood Editor

Invest in the Products That Help You Get a Good Night’s Rest
“My husband and I both have become addicted to a sleeping machine, this one is our favorite. It really helps us fall into a deep and restful sleep.” — Shaz Rajashekar, co-founder of Shaz + Kiks
